    "It is sad at times past to hear people get riled up and say such talk when they really do not know what they are talking about and are upset with losing a football game or basketball game or both. I hate to lose in any sport but it is not something to slam Dan Reneau about week in and week out as many have done for the past few years.

    As a matter of fact, Dr. Reneau has shown leadership in the hiring of Derek Dooley and Kerry Rupp. He also has a major plan in place that is working. We have to be patient and put in our own support too."



    Yes, Reneau has shown tremendous leadership in the last several months.

    The big picture was that he had turned his back on athletics for years. It was not a few losses that had people calling for his head, it was his total neglect for athletics.

    Like it or not, it was the public outcry of fans that finally embarrassed him to the point of doing something about it. You see what he is doing now, it would have never happened if everyone continued to let things ride the way they had been going.

    Karl Malone offered his "deal" to tech LAST year, it was not taken. It took a total turnaround by Dr. Reneau for us to take Karl up on his very generous offer.



    This is a great time to be a Tech fan, but please do not throw the negative crowd under the bus. If it was not for us, you would still be talking about how great Keith Richard and Jack Bicknell were.

    I too am grateful for the sudden strong commitment exhibited by our President in recent months to Louisiana Tech Athletics. I come from the thought of, "Better late than never." I really am not interested at all in rehashing all of the negative aspects of Tech athletics but, like ALL of our BB&Bers, READY to move to the 2020 goals. I also would really LOVE to know what the Tech 2020 Plan is for Tech athletics.

    We are being told again & again that because our President has stepped up with great hires & immediate facilities improvements, that we must step up as well with our contributions. I buy that & I think most of you do as well &, without KNOWING the specific increase in CHAMPS giving in recent months, I would feel comfortable in saying that the increase has been in double digits (%) & perhaps even in triple digits. I personally know of many contributors in recent days that have given to CHAMPS, some in a very significant way, that have NEVER given in the past. IF we ever see a current record of ACCURATE CHAMPS GIVING, I really believe that we will all be most impressed.

    Now, there is another part of this equation and, you guessed it, it involves our President. We are going to GIVE & GIVE & GIVE. We Tech fans are going to hold up our end of the deal. BUT, it is way past time for our athletic administration to HELP US by maximizing the revenue opportunities inherit in our athletic programs. I know you are sick of hearing me say this but I will continue to repeat it over & over again. There is money to be made to support our giving in ticket sales, concessions, souvenir sales, parking, naming rights, licensing, radio & television, along with potential bowl & tournament revenue. There are corporate sponsors out there frothing at the mouth to join what they KNOW is going to be a special period of time in Tech athletics. There are specific big game sponsors just waiting to be asked, like so many of our individuals have been waiting to be asked. IF, IF, IF we will hire a corp of BUSINESSMEN to MANAGE our athletic program, we will NAIL our Tech 2020 vision, whatever that vision may be. AND, the TIME to bring these people on board is YESTERDAY!!
